over signing is not the issue. we could sign 34 counting the 6 early entries and sign collect 28 more tomorrow. the issue is that only 26, the 6 early entry players and 20 that sign tomorrrow can be enrolled in August. SO any over that number have to be nonqualifiers or have some agree to gray shirt. gray shirts won't happen because these kids can get offers for D-1 ships.

so anything over 26 that qualifies we likely have to release or end up with sanctions of some sort
